Wherever CIET is active, capacity building is part of the process. An important capacity-building component of the project is assisting health planners and managers to organise their efforts increasingly in relation to the results they achieve in terms of impact and coverage and help improve local and state government capacity for results-based management of health.
Health planners from state ministries of health and local government departments in Bauchi and Cross River states have attended a course in epidemiology and evidence-based planning with two modules of two weeks each in February and June 2011, a three week module in May 2012 and a one week module in May 2013.
Participants and instructors at module one of the course in epidemiology and evidence-based planning, Abuja, February, 2011
This course is also a key element in the development of an Open and Distance Learning Masters course in Epidemiology geared to the needs of these same state and local government health planners and managers.
